Power Solutions International (PSIX) Income towards Parent Company (2010 - 2026)
Power Solutions International (PSIX) recorded quarterly Income towards Parent Company of $7.3 million in Q1 2026, down 54.39% quarter-over-quarter from $16.1 million in Q4 2025, and down 61.57% on a YoY basis from $19.1 million in Q1 2025.
